The UK Government is launching a call for evidence seeking views on potential measures to manage stocks of sandeel and Norway pout in UK waters.
- Stakeholders are asked to share views on the management of sandeel stocks and Norway pout
- UK to use freedoms as an independent coastal state to explore new measures to address stock declines
- Sandeels and Norway pout play a key role in the wider ecosystem as a food source for commercial fish stocks and marine mammals
